## 2.8.1 — Key rotation

Rotated the signing key for the Stormline weather-alert fan-out service. Old key is revoked effective this release; alerts signed with it will fail verification at the Gullwharf edge relays. Reviewers: confirm the fan-out workers pick up the new key on restart and that no queued alerts were signed during the cutover window. Retry logic unchanged. The replacement deploy key for verification environments is included below.

rollout seal: bky4_x7Gc

### FAQ: How does the Quillback autoscaler decide when to scale?

Short version: Quillback watches queue depth on the ingest topics and adds workers when the backlog stays above threshold for two minutes. It scales down way more slowly, on purpose — thrashing was a nightmare before. New folks sometimes panic when the graph spikes; don't, it usually self-corrects. If the autoscaler itself wedges, you'll need to restart its control loop manually. The passphrase to unlock the control loop console is below.

unlock words, yawig-kagef: gordor-holvan-ulaael-pramir-ulaiel-tamdor

Subject: On-call handover — SDK parity

Hi Devika,

Welcome to the rotation. Most support escalations this week concern gaps between the Lumenreach Java and Swift SDKs. Retry semantics and pagination helpers shipped in Java but not Swift yet, so expect tickets about inconsistent behavior. Don't promise dates; point customers to the published roadmap instead. The current parity matrix is maintained on the internal page linked below.

dashboard of tawef-yageg = https://jira.torvaworks.corp/deploy/merge_requests/board/settings/issue/settings/build/86c86b97dff3e2041bd6f497

The Tarnwick date localizer still assumes day-month order for every locale east of the pivot list — that's wrong, use the CLDR-style pattern table we vendored instead. Also stop caching formatters per-thread; cache per-locale or memory climbs fast. Fallback behavior should be explicit: unknown locale means ISO output, never a silent guess. The formatter cache and fallback limits are controlled by the constants below.

tuning constants:
RATE_LIMITS = {
    "wenwyn": 1,
    "zorix": 10,
    "oliix": 2,
    "holael": 10,
}